On September 3 and 4, 2025, BOOK 2.0 returned for its third edition, held at the Champalimaud Foundation, a symbol of excellence, innovation, and progress in Lisbon.
Organized by APEL, the event was open to the public and brought together publishers, authors, researchers, and readers to reflect on the future of books, reading, and knowledge.
The Reinvention of Species
From the earliest cave paintings to the digital revolution, the instinct to tell stories has been one of the driving forces of human evolution. The need to transmit and preserve knowledge has shaped civilizations, fueling progress in science, culture, and society.
The third edition of Book 2.0 invited reflection on the role of knowledge and books in building the future. In a time of rapid transformation, marked by digitalization, the event encouraged participants to consider how access to reading and the promotion of literacy can help create a more conscious and resilient society.
Book Purchase and
Reading Habits Study
The results of the study 'Book Purchase and Reading Habits in Portugal' were presented during the 3rd edition of BOOK 2.0, which took place on September 3 and 4 at the Champalimaud Foundation in Lisbon. This analysis offers updated and essential information on Portuguese habits, which is fundamental to promoting a stronger and more accessible reading culture in Portugal.
